The Woodlands, Texas
Presidential margin, 2004–2024
Democratic minus Republican, by election
| Year | Margin (D minus R) |
|---|---|
| 2004 | −55.2% |
| 2008 | −47.1% |
| 2012 | −54.9% |
| 2016 | −32.7% |
| 2020 | −23.2% |
| 2024 | −25.2% |

The Woodlands has long anchored Republican strength in Montgomery County, but population growth and demographic diversification have quietly tightened margins in countywide races over the past decade.
Across the recorded series it reached a Republican high of 55.2 points in 2004. Between 2020 and 2024 the city moved 2.1 points toward the Republican candidate; the 2024 margin was 25.2 points.
A population of 121,002, a 65% non-Hispanic-white share, and a median household income of $140,701 describe the city. The city's voting pattern over the last decade is most similar to that of Grapevine and Rowlett.
